How to prepare for a job interview at Aspects Beauty Company
✨Know Your Fragrances
Make sure you brush up on your fragrance knowledge before the interview. Familiarise yourself with popular brands and their signature scents, as well as any new releases. This will show your passion for the role and help you connect with the interviewer.
✨Showcase Your Customer Service Skills
As a Fragrance Sales Consultant, excellent customer service is key. Prepare examples of how you've gone the extra mile for customers in previous roles. Think about specific situations where you turned a negative experience into a positive one.
✨Dress to Impress
Since you'll be working in a retail environment, it's important to present yourself well. Choose an outfit that reflects the brand's image and shows you're serious about the position. A polished appearance can make a great first impression.
✨Ask Insightful Questions
Prepare some thoughtful questions to ask at the end of the interview. This could be about the team dynamics, training opportunities, or how success is measured in the role. It shows your genuine interest in the position and helps you assess if it's the right fit for you.
